Closed emontnemery closed 1 month ago
[!WARNING]
Rate Limit Exceeded
@ludeeus has exceeded the limit for the number of commits or files that can be reviewed per hour. Please wait 53 minutes and 45 seconds before requesting another review.
How to resolve this issue?
After the wait time has elapsed, a review can be triggered using the `@coderabbitai review` command as a PR comment. Alternatively, push new commits to this PR. We recommend that you space out your commits to avoid hitting the rate limit.How do rate limits work?
CodeRabbit enforces hourly rate limits for each developer per organization. Our paid plans have higher rate limits than the trial, open-source and free plans. In all cases, we re-allow further reviews after a brief timeout. Please see our [FAQ](https://coderabbit.ai/docs/faq) for further information.Commits
Files that changed from the base of the PR and between 9613a5ef4e913e6fa4adf895e922a12a758c9c44 and 141c504f1aae45fe523d58589ba72a7b60646896.
The changes across the various files primarily focus on simplifying code by removing unnecessary try-except blocks and conditional logic. This streamlining affects the initialization of HomeAssistant
instances, the import of json_loads
, and the handling of test setup and configuration entries. These modifications enhance code clarity and maintainability by eliminating redundant checks and fallback mechanisms.
File Path | Change Summary |
---|---|
action/action.py |
Simplified hacs.hass initialization by removing try-except block. |
custom_components/hacs/utils/json.py |
Simplified import of json_loads by removing fallback to standard json module. |
scripts/data/generate_category_data.py |
Simplified self.hass initialization in AdjustedHacs class by removing try-except block. |
tests/__init__.py |
Simplified handling of loader.async_suggest_report_issue by removing conditional check. |
tests/common.py |
Removed version-based conditional logic and try-except block in add_to_hass and create_config_entry . |
tests/conftest.py |
Refactored setup_integration fixture to reorganize assertions and tracking of async_suggest_report_issue . |
The changes are primarily code simplifications and do not introduce new features or significantly alter control flow, so no sequence diagrams are necessary for these modifications.
Thank you for using CodeRabbit. We offer it for free to the OSS community and would appreciate your support in helping us grow. If you find it useful, would you consider giving us a shout-out on your favorite social media?
@coderabbitai review